Best Hawaiian Beaches
The culture of Hawaii and the beauty of its beaches make this state one of the most popular tourist attractions in the United States. Honaunau Bay, Hawaii White sand and palm tress dot the landscape of this serene Hawaiian location. This area is a favorite among snorkeling enthusiasts and divers as Honaunau Bay is home to beautiful coral reef formations, tropical fish, and other interesting marine life such as the green sea turtle. The Pu ‘uhonua o Honaunau National Historical Park is the area’s top attraction other than the beaches. Meaning “place of refuge,” this historic location is maintained by the National Park Service. Visitors are charged a $5 admission to take in the wonderful Hawaiian sights and culture that can be found there. Wailea Beach, Hawaii Wailea Beach is home to excellent swimming locations, as well as beaches that offer scenic places to work on a tan. Between January and May, whales travel to the area and thrill those on land who catch a glimpse of these majestic animals. The arrival of the large mammals also provides the livelihood for the many whale watching tours. Kapalua Beach This beach is sheltered from the otherwise rough waves and treats visitors to the finest in dining and relaxation along with excellent beaches that are fun for the whole family. The town of Lahaina is close by and serves as a favorite stop for those looking for shopping adventure and great places to eat.
